What is libqt6gui6

libqt6gui6 is:

Qt is a cross-platform C++ application framework. Qt’s primary feature is its rich set of widgets that provide standard GUI functionality.

The QtGui module extends QtCore with GUI functionality.

There are three methods to install libqt6gui6 on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install libqt6gui6 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install libqt6gui6 using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install libqt6gui6

How To Uninstall libqt6gui6 on Debian 12

To uninstall only the libqt6gui6 package we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get remove libqt6gui6

Uninstall libqt6gui6 And Its Dependencies

To uninstall libqt6gui6 and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 12, we can use the command below: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ove libqt6gui6

Remove libqt6gui6 Configurations and Data

To remove libqt6gui6 configuration and data from Debian 12 we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y purge libqt6gui6

Remove libqt6gui6 configuration, data, and all of its dependencies

We can use the following command to remove libqt6gui6 config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ge libqt6gui6
